Output fd76c4dd8e56081d3ed208b84d6029b9fb755570a41bfbbf4856913755b50339:0

value
13785890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04c4fd708f1d0e375801f72233647396b79feda1 OP_EQUAL
address
328EcR69hvHpxs11Wi8nyYeQaP7CzaFnRN
transaction
fd76c4dd8e56081d3ed208b84d6029b9fb755570a41bfbbf4856913755b50339
confirmations
340747
spent
true